Several key factors are propelling the growth of the light wall formwork market. Firstly, the increasing demand for faster construction timelines is a major driver. Light wall formwork systems significantly reduce labor costs and installation time compared to traditional methods, allowing for quicker project completion. Secondly, the rising emphasis on sustainable construction practices is boosting the adoption of these systems. Many light wall formwork options utilize recyclable materials and generate less waste, making them an environmentally responsible choice. Thirdly, the escalating costs of labor in many regions are pushing construction companies to adopt technologies that enhance productivity and minimize reliance on manual labor, with light wall formwork being a key solution. Additionally, the growing adoption of prefabrication and modular construction methods is driving market growth, as these techniques seamlessly integrate with light wall formwork for efficient construction workflows. Finally, advancements in material science, leading to stronger yet lighter formwork components, further enhance their appeal and contribute to increased market demand. These combined factors are expected to contribute to sustained market expansion throughout the forecast period.
Despite the significant growth potential, several challenges and restraints could impede the expansion of the light wall formwork market. One major concern is the potential for higher initial investment costs compared to traditional formwork systems, which may deter smaller construction firms with limited budgets. Furthermore, the durability and lifespan of some lighter formwork solutions need to be further improved to match the robustness of conventional systems. Concerns about the potential for damage during transportation and handling, especially for larger panels, could also pose a challenge. The lack of skilled labor proficient in handling and installing specific light wall formwork systems might create bottlenecks in certain regions. Finally, fluctuating raw material prices, especially for certain advanced composites, can introduce unpredictable cost variations, impacting project profitability and potentially dampening overall market growth. Addressing these challenges requires a collaborative effort among manufacturers, contractors, and regulatory bodies to improve material specifications, training programs, and cost-effective solutions.

The 24-inch type of light wall formwork holds a considerable market share due to its versatility and suitability for a wide range of construction applications. This size strikes a balance between ease of handling, construction speed and structural integrity. It finds applications in both temporary and permanent building projects, ensuring a widespread demand.
